header{z-index:1000000;background-color:#0000;justify-content:space-between;align-items:center;width:100%;height:82px;padding:20px 90px;display:flex;position:relative}header.exp-header{background-color:#fff!important}@media screen and (max-width:991px){header.header-fixed{z-index:10000;position:fixed;inset:0}}header .header-wrapper{z-index:10001;justify-content:space-between;align-items:center;display:flex}header .header-wrapper .logo{object-fit:contain;z-index:10000000;height:21px;position:relative}header .header-wrapper .header-data{justify-content:flex-end;gap:31px;width:fit-content;display:flex}header .header-wrapper .header-data .m-link{letter-spacing:-.6px;vertical-align:middle;color:#fffc;font-family:Afacad;font-size:20px;font-weight:400;line-height:25.6px}header .header-wrapper .header-data .m-link.experience-header-color{color:#02053a99}header .header-wrapper .header-data .m-link.experience-header-color-get{color:#02053a99;border:1px solid #02053a1a}header .header-wrapper .header-data .get-in-touch{border:1px solid #ffffff2e;border-radius:8px;width:max-content;padding:8px 20px;font-weight:500}@media screen and (max-width:991px){header .header-wrapper .header-data{z-index:1000000;background:linear-gradient(139.33deg,#040836 25.75%,#8a38f5 113.75%);flex-direction:column;justify-content:flex-start;align-items:flex-start;width:100vw;height:100vh;padding:101px 90px;display:none;position:absolute;top:0;left:0}header .header-wrapper .header-data.header-data-display{gap:9px;display:flex}header .header-wrapper .header-data .m-link{letter-spacing:-.75px;text-align:center;background:#ffffff03;border:1px solid #ffffff17;border-radius:12px;justify-content:center;align-items:center;width:100%;padding:14px 37px;font-family:Darker Grotesque;font-size:25px;font-weight:600;line-height:100%;display:flex;color:#ffffffbf!important}header .header-wrapper .header-data .get-in-touch{letter-spacing:-.75px;text-align:center;background:#dcff55;border:1px solid #dcff55;border-radius:12px;justify-content:center;align-items:center;width:100%;padding:14px 37px;font-family:Darker Grotesque;font-size:25px;font-weight:600;line-height:100%;display:flex;color:#02053a!important}}@media screen and (max-width:768px){header .header-wrapper .header-data{padding:90px 21px}}header .header-hamburger{width:fit-content;display:none}@media screen and (max-width:991px){header{height:64px;padding:0 90px}header .header-hamburger{z-index:10000000;display:flex;position:relative}}@media screen and (max-width:768px){header{padding:0 21px}}
footer{background:#04041a;padding:64px 90px 80px}footer div{display:block}footer .footer-up{margin-bottom:32px}footer .footer-up .footer-up-grid{justify-content:space-between;gap:20px;display:flex}footer .footer-up .footer-up-grid .footer-up-data1{width:100%;max-width:388px}footer .footer-up .footer-up-grid .footer-up-data1 p{letter-spacing:-.36px;vertical-align:middle;color:#fff9;width:100%;max-width:280px;font-family:Afacad;font-size:18px;font-weight:400;line-height:27.6px}@media screen and (max-width:768px){footer .footer-up .footer-up-grid .footer-up-data1{max-width:100%}footer .footer-up .footer-up-grid .footer-up-data1 p{max-width:100%;font-size:16px}}footer .footer-up .footer-up-grid .footer-up-data2{gap:53px;display:flex}footer .footer-up .footer-up-grid .footer-up-data2 .footer-up-main-grid{flex-direction:column;gap:20px;display:flex}footer .footer-up .footer-up-grid .footer-up-data2 p{letter-spacing:-1px;vertical-align:middle;color:#ffffffe5;font-family:Darker Grotesque;font-size:26px;font-weight:700;line-height:39px}footer .footer-up .footer-up-grid .footer-up-data2 .footer-up-main-grid-data{flex-direction:column;gap:12px;display:flex}footer .footer-up .footer-up-grid .footer-up-data2 .m-link{letter-spacing:-.36px;vertical-align:middle;color:#fff9;padding:1.25px 0 .34px;font-family:Afacad;font-size:18px;font-weight:400;line-height:27.6px}@media screen and (max-width:768px){footer .footer-up .footer-up-grid .footer-up-data2{flex-direction:column;gap:17px}footer .footer-up .footer-up-grid .footer-up-data2 p{font-size:24px;line-height:100%}footer .footer-up .footer-up-grid .footer-up-data2 .footer-up-main-grid-data{gap:4px}footer .footer-up .footer-up-grid .footer-up-data2 .m-link{letter-spacing:-.32px;font-size:16px}}footer .footer-down{border-top:1px solid #2b40f57a;justify-content:space-between;align-items:center;padding-top:40px;display:flex}footer .footer-down .footer-down-title{letter-spacing:-.36px;vertical-align:middle;color:#fff9;width:max-content;font-family:Afacad;font-size:18px;font-weight:400;line-height:27.6px}footer .footer-down .footer-down-link{gap:16px;width:fit-content;display:flex}footer .footer-down .footer-down-link .m-link{letter-spacing:0;vertical-align:middle;color:#ffffffbf;font-family:Poppins;font-size:14px;font-weight:400;line-height:150%;text-decoration:none}footer .footer-down .developer-link{letter-spacing:-.36px;vertical-align:middle;color:#fff9;font-family:Afacad;font-size:18px;font-weight:400;line-height:27.6px;text-decoration:none}footer .footer-down .developer-link:hover{text-decoration:underline}@media screen and (max-width:768px){footer{padding:51px 21px}footer .footer-up-grid{flex-direction:column}footer .footer-down{flex-direction:column;align-items:flex-start;padding-top:28px}footer .footer-down .footer-down-title{order:2;width:fit-content;padding-bottom:16px}footer .footer-down .footer-down-link{order:1}}
.loader-overlay{z-index:9999999;background:#ffffffb3;justify-content:center;align-items:center;display:flex;position:fixed;inset:0}.loader-overlay .loader{border:6px solid #914fff;border-top-color:#fff;border-radius:50%;width:48px;height:48px;animation:1s linear infinite spin}@keyframes spin{to{transform:rotate(360deg)}}
*{box-sizing:border-box;margin:0;padding:0}div{width:100%;display:flex}html{scroll-behavior:smooth}body{font-family:var(--font-darker-grotesque),sans-serif}button,a{cursor:pointer}.w-10{width:10%}.w-20{width:20%}.w-25{width:25%}.w-30{width:30%}.w-40{width:40%}.w-50{width:50%}.w-60{width:60%}.w-70{width:70%}.w-80{width:80%}.w-90{width:90%}.w-100{width:100%}.hide{display:none}.w-auto{width:auto}
